Should there be a recycling law for the Island?

Clara Isaac at Tynwald, where she was inspired to post to social media about a recycling law.

A woman who runs a recycling collection company is proposing for a recycling law to be brought in here.

Clara Isaac, who began Recycle Collective Limited three years ago with Laura Jennings, posted to social media to say that a first step would be for all metals and glass to be recycled.

She says she'd like to see a law that bans either material being put in general waste to be incinerated:

The government wants the Island to be net zero by 2050.
